Prime Minister Dr. Ralph Gonsalves says the government of St. Vincent and the Grenadines will be assisting the people in the northern Leeward Islands who were severely affected due to the passage of Hurricane Irma.

Speaking on Friday on the Shakeup Program aired here on WEFM, Prime Minister Gonsalves said this country is solidarity with all the countries impacted by Irma, as well as with the city of Huston in the US state of Texas, which suffered significant damage as a result of Hurricane Harvey, in August.

He said the government will be sending 50,000 US dollars to the British Virgin Islands (BVI) and 50,000US dollars to Antigua and Barbuda to aid in the relief efforts in those islands.

Dr. Gonsalves said he had spoken with Antigua and Barbuda’s Prime Minister Gaston Browne, and stated that arrangements are being made to have technical personnel from here be sent to assist with the reconstruction works to be undertaken in Barbuda.

He said arrangements are also being made to have a boat sent to Antigua.

According to Prime Minister Gonsalves, significant monies will be needed to assist with the reconstruction of Barbuda.
